Frequently asked questions
Is stainless steel the right material for a grill tool?
Stainless steel handles high heat well, resists rust after exposure to rain and humidity, and is easy to clean with a brush or dishwasher. For grill tools, it is one of the most practical choices. The tradeoff is that bare metal handles conduct heat, so check whether the handle has an insulating grip before grabbing it off a hot grill.
How do I keep a stainless grill tool from rusting?
Stainless steel is corrosion-resistant but not fully rustproof under all conditions. Rinse off food residue and grease after each cook, dry the tool before storing it, and keep it out of standing water. A quick wipe with a little cooking oil before a long storage period helps protect the surface.
